Water Resistance Strength

The next step for you will be to look into the strength and efficiency of the connectors’ water resistance. If a solder connection accidentally gets wet, you run the risk of short circuits - or, in the most extreme of cases, perhaps even a fire hazard.

Water resistance helps you to protect the solder connections from damage done by water. But, you also need to know the extent to which the water resistance actually lasts. Most solder connectors come with IP67 water resistance, which prevents water from entering into the connector as soon as it has been heated and the connector has shrunk.

Nevertheless, you should also keep in mind that IP67 water resistance only protects the circuit from water levels between 15 cm and 1 metre, and for just about 30 minutes. Put your soldering electrical connectors anything deeper or longer than this, and you might still have a problem.

To that end, look into whether you can get waterproof electrical connectors that has an even higher waterproof rating. Size Compatibility

While working with electrical circuits, you will be working with different types of wires. This includes wires that have different size, with different diameter ratings and thickness numbers.

Due to this, you need to ensure that the solder wire connector you use should be compatible with the size of your wire itself. Just as it is with electrical wires, the size rating of a solder wire connector will come in handy. Given in American Wire Gauge (AWG), this metric comes in different forms. You can find solder wire connector options available in the following sizes:

  • 10-12 AWG
  • 14-16 AWG
  • 18-22 AWG
  • 24-26 AWG, and much more.



To help, you can pick a solder wire connector package that offers different sizes. This way, you have a versatile product that easily works regardless of the different sizes of wires you have.
